Sponsored Bills
This Menu Item Is Currently Expanded.
HB 444
- (0931L.01P)
Revises Criminal Activity Forfeiture Act.
HB 457
- (0930L.04C)
Creates School Building Property Tax Relief Fund grant program for school capital improvements; funds program through incremental use of gaming proceeds.
HB 581
- (1516S.05C)
Revises the laws on agriculture and water.
HB 623
- (1609L.01I)
Requires that the underwriting of transportation bonds first be solicited from companies incorporated and having a principal office located in this state.
HB 762
- (1642L.16T)
Requires HMOs to provide direct access to ob/gyn services, bone density testing and contraceptive coverage, and notify enrollees of cancer screenings available through their insurance.
HB 897
- (1864L.03T)
Prohibits Department of Revenue from gathering or including on driver's license any information for which it does not have statutory authority.
HB 943
- (1992L.04I)
Establishes an endowment and trust fund for the tobacco settlement moneys, with a referendum clause.
HB 959
- (2080L.01I)
Requires legislative approval before Department of Transportation may designate a highway as limited-access, and requires reapproval of all highways currently so designated.
HB 966
- (2251L.02I)
Permits municipalities to set speed limits on state roads and highways within the municipality, without approval of Department of Transportation.
HB 980
- (2285L.01I)
Requires Department of Transportation to approve contractors to bid within thirty days of application.
HB 1000
- (2203L.05T)
Changes the composition of congressional districts.
HB 1007
- (2306L.01I)
Allows legal settlements received by the state to be appropriated for education and health care.
HB 1008
- (2255L.01I)
Requires Department of Transportation to conduct public proceedings before limiting access to a state highway.
HB 1025
- (2312L.02I)
Creates tax holiday each August between 2001 and 2003.
HJR 20
- (1175L.01I)
Proposes a constitutional amendment guaranteeing the right to hunt and fish.
HJR 23
- (2305L.01I)
Proposes a constitutional amendment to require funds from legal settlements to be used for health care and education.
